Commercial Solar Maintenance: What NJ Facility Managers Need to Know
Commercial solar systems are designed for 25 to 30 year operational lifespans. Over that horizon, maintenance quality determines whether the system continues producing at expected levels — or quietly underperforms while production guarantees go unclaimed. Here’s what NJ facility managers need to know about commercial solar O&M.
The Five Things That Need Active Management
- Production monitoring — 24/7 per-inverter performance tracking with deviation alerts
- Physical inspections — at least 4 annual visual + thermal imaging surveys
- NJ SuSI quarterly reporting — required for ongoing credit payments from NJBPU
- Warranty administration — manufacturer warranty claims for failing components
- Production guarantee enforcement — comparing actual vs PVsyst-modeled production
What Continuous Monitoring Catches
Without monitoring, system underperformance is invisible until you notice your utility bill didn’t drop as expected. Good monitoring catches:
- Per-inverter performance deviation (early failure detection)
- String-level current variance (failing module identification)
- Inverter fault codes — auto-clearing vs persistent
- Communications uptime (data flow integrity)
- Soiling and vegetation growth via production trends
Most commercial inverters have 10 to 15 year service life. Module degradation is 0.5%/year for tier-1 panels. Without monitoring, you can lose 10-15% of production over a decade without knowing it.
NJ SuSI Quarterly Reporting
For systems registered under the Successor Solar Incentive program, NJBPU requires quarterly metered production reports for ongoing credit payments. Missing the reporting window can interrupt credit issuance — which represents real revenue. For a 250 kW system at typical SuSI rates, missed credits cost approximately $7,000 per quarter.

Annual Visual + Thermal Inspections
Four times per year, an O&M technician should be on your roof or ground-mount site for:
- Visual inspection of all modules (cracking, delamination, hot spots, discoloration)
- Thermal imaging survey (infrared camera) of all strings and inverters
- Inverter inspection — ventilation, capacitor health, firmware verification
- BOS (Balance of System) inspection — combiners, disconnects, grounding
- Racking and ballast inspection
- Roof condition check around penetrations
- Vegetation review
Warranty Claim Administration
Manufacturers (Q CELLS, REC, Silfab for modules; SolarEdge, SMA, Enphase for inverters) have specific RMA procedures for warranty claims. Missing the documentation window or failing the inspection requirements can void warranty coverage on individual components — turning a $0 replacement into a $2,000-$5,000 out-of-pocket cost.
Production Guarantee Enforcement
A production guarantee is only valuable if you can prove the threshold is missed. Without monitoring data, comparing actual vs PVsyst-modeled production is impossible. With monitoring, the annual reconciliation is straightforward:
- Year 1-2: guaranteed 95% of PVsyst model
- Year 3-10: guaranteed 90% of PVsyst model
- If actual falls below threshold and cause is addressable (soiling, vegetation, inverter underperformance), O&M provider resolves at no cost
